How much hummus can a diabetic eat?

Chickpeas, like other legumes, are high in fiber and are lower on the glycemic index, according to Harvard Medical School, making them a good choice to help manage blood sugar levels. For a healthy snack, spread 1 to 2 tbsp of hummus evenly over 12 thin whole-grain crackers.

Does hummus lower blood sugar?

A small study found that eating a low sugar snack with hummus led to a 5% decrease in afternoon blood sugar levels compared with eating granola bars that had a higher sugar content ( 7 ).

What kind of hummus is good for diabetics?

Roasted Chickpeas

Chickpeas, also known as garbanzo beans, are an incredibly healthy legume. There are close to 14.5 grams of protein and 12.5 grams of fiber in a 1-cup (164-gram) serving of chickpeas, making them an excellent snack for people with diabetes.

Is hummus high in sugars?

Hummus is relatively low in sugar, especially when compared with other popular snack products. Eating fiber-rich foods such as hummus may help a person feel fuller and support better control of blood sugar.

How can diabetics make hummus?

In a bowl, soak 1 cup of dried chickpeas in 3 cups of water overnight. Drain, and reserve liquid. In a blender or food processor, combine the chickpeas, garlic, lemon juice, and tahini. Blend on low speed, gradually adding reserved liquid, until desired consistency is achieved.

Is it OK to eat hummus everyday?

Hummus is a truly nutritious snack that is good to include in your daily diet in moderation and when combined with a diverse range of food. Hummus can be a part of the daily diet if consumed in moderation, and the rest of the diet contains a diverse range of foods.
